Review of Web Mapping: Eras, Trends and Directions
TL;DR: This paper reviews the developments of web mapping from the first static online map images to the current highly interactive, multi-sourced web mapping services that have been increasingly moved to cloud computing platforms.

Applying cusum-based methods for the detection of outbreaks of Ross River virus disease in Western Australia
TL;DR: The retrospective analysis of historical data suggests that the negative binomial cusum provides greater sensitivity for the detection of outbreaks of RRv disease at low false alarm levels, and decreased timeliness early in the outbreak period.

Use of Soil Moisture Variability in Artificial Neural Network Retrieval of Soil Moisture
TL;DR: A novel approach that utilizes information on the variability of soil moisture, in terms of its mean and standard deviation for a (sub) region of spatial dimension up to 40 km, is used to improve the current retrieval accuracy of the ANN method.
